Factors to Consider When Choosing a Tattoo Machine Coil Rebuild Kit

When you’re picking a tattoo machine coil rebuild kit, consider the material quality to guarantee durability and performance. Make sure the kit is compatible with your machine to avoid any installation hassles. Also, think about ease of installation and whether the kit comes with support or a warranty for added peace of mind.

Material Quality Importance

Choosing a tattoo machine coil rebuild kit means considering material quality, as it directly impacts the durability and performance of your machine. High carbon steel is essential; it enhances your machine’s lifespan and stability. When you opt for high-quality materials, you benefit from increased wear and corrosion resistance, minimizing failures during operation. The machining accuracy of coil springs also plays a significant role in your machine’s performance, ensuring consistent results with every tattoo. On the flip side, using inferior materials can lead to frequent breakdowns and increased wear, negatively affecting reliability. Investing in quality materials not only boosts efficiency but also reduces maintenance costs, making it a smart choice for both professionals and beginners.

Compatibility With Machines

Verifying compatibility with your tattoo machine is vital for achieving ideal performance from a coil rebuild kit. Start by confirming that the kit matches your specific type of tattoo machine, whether it’s manual or automatic. Look for kits that include springs fitting your machine’s front, back, and rear configurations to optimize functionality. High machining accuracy in coil springs is essential for stability during operation, so don’t overlook this factor. Additionally, check the materials—high carbon steel springs offer durability and resistance to wear and corrosion. Finally, consider your machine’s range of operational needs; the rebuild kit should accommodate various coil types and performance requirements to guarantee you get the most out of your tattooing experience.

Performance and Precision

After confirming compatibility with your tattoo machine, the next step is to focus on performance and precision. The performance of a coil rebuild kit directly impacts your machine’s stability and accuracy, which are vital for high-quality tattoos. Look for coil springs made from high-carbon steel, as they offer exceptional strength, wear resistance, and corrosion resistance, enhancing overall performance. Additionally, make certain that the coils align with your machine’s operational voltage range—typically between 6-10 volts—for ideal results. Precision in coil design is essential, as it allows for better control over needle movement, resulting in cleaner lines and more detailed work during your tattooing sessions. Prioritize these factors to elevate your artistry and guarantee lasting results.
